How much is it to travel in Ukraine
As you may have guessed from the topic of the article we are going to talk about how much is it to travel in Ukraine. Well, everything depends on several factors:
1. Where are you from;
2. Your Destination;
3. Accommodations;
4. Food and drinks;
Accommodations
At this point, everything is also very individual and depends on the importance of comfort for you. In light of this, there are following options to stay.
If you are one of this people who need daily service and the ability to order room service, you, definitely, have to put at a hotel, but this option is very expensive.
You can rent an apartment from Airbnb website. It is very easy. Renting is cheaper, but as for me, much more comfortable. You have your home – a corner where you can make a meal by yourself.
By the way, usually there are much more space in an apartment than in a hotel room.
On the same Airbnb, the function of renting a single room in an apartment is also available. Of course, you will need to share bathroom with other visitors but you are saving your money.
Hostels are also becoming popular among tourists in Ukraine. Mostly students use this type of housing, but it is justified. You are coming to enjoy the city not the apartment.
Food & drinks
Well, if you are a traveler, then there is no compromise when it comes to sit in a cafe and enjoy national dishes. Feel the atmosphere of the city and its inhabitants; listen to unfamiliar speech – free impressions. You can find more information about the national Ukrainian food on our website.
Average price for 2 days in Kiev
Usually people make small trips over the weekends, and most travelers would like to see the capital of the country, so let`s sum everything up and count how much is it to spend the weekend in Kiev.
Day 1 – Friday
1. Transfer. You arrive in Kiev in the morning, and you need to get to the city center or place you have decided to stay. You can:
• catch the bus – about 4 USD ;
• take a cab – about 20 USD ;
•
2. Check in. You have already choose the type of housing that suits you, and you definitely have paid for:
• Hotel – about 130 USD for weekend;
• Apartment – about 70 USD for weekend;
• Room in the apartment – about 40 USD for weekend;
• Bed in a hostel – about 20 USD for weekend.
3. Now you have taken the shower and had rest after the flight and I am sure you are hungry. Well, it is time to:
• Take a meal at a restaurant – average bill in Kiev – is about 20 USD
• Make a meal by yourself - about 40 USD (it is enough for the whole weekend)
4. It`s time to explore the city. Most of the sights in Kiev are free. However, you have to pay for museums or cathedrals visiting.
• Be ready to spend about 10-20 USD
If you still don`t know what to see in Kiev you can find this information on our web site.
5. You are probably tired of walking around the city, but full of positive emotions. It`s time to have lunch. You can:
• eat something you`ve made
• take a meal at a restaurant – average bill is still about 20 USD
6. I am sure you haven`t seen everything yet, so let`s continue to explore the capital. If you are tired of walking, it is possible to use public transport:
• Subway, bus or tram – about 0, 5 USD for one trip
• Cab – about 5 USD for one trip
7. It`s already the evening, which means that the nightlife begins soon. If you like parties and nightclubs – Kiev has everything to impress you.
• Visiting of some clubs is free, but mostly it`s about 5 USD
• Average bill in the club is about 25-30 USD
Day 2 – Saturday
1. I am sure you had some fun last night, didn`t you? Now it`s a good time to relax. There are many places in Kiev, where you can get high-quality SPA.
• Cosmetic products for the face – about 15 USD
• Body care – about 30 USD
• Massage – about 25 USD
• Sauna bath and Pool – about 15 USD
2. Don`t forget about breakfast and lunch. There are still the same options:
• to eat something you`ve made
• to take a meal at a restaurant – average bill is still about 20 USD
3. Now you have some time for walking around the city and get ready for checking out.
4. The weekend is over and it is time to go home. Use the same transfer.
• catch the bus – about 4 USD ;
• take a cab – about 20 USD ;
So, how much is it to travel in Ukraine? It depends only on your wishes and opportunities. Average price for weekend in Kiev is about 250 USD + tickets to Ukraine.

The name if topic seems like the name of my blog, But anyway, a lot of guys ask me What to visit in Ukraine?, Which place do you suggest to visit in Ukraine, so I decided to write this article and describe shortly al places which you can visit. And you can choose just the most attractive for you.
First of all you need to understand that Ukraine is very big and there are a lot of different places. I mean that there are wooden mountains, Black sea, Asovian sea, big cities, small cities, villages, lakes, kind of desert.... So for people who love mountains, skiing, hiking, I can suggest one places, and for people who love big cities and architecture - another places. Anyway, now I am going to gice you some ideas what to visit in Ukraine
Kyiv
Of course in any country you need to visit the capital. The capital of Ukraine is Kyiv. What to visit in Kyiv?
St.Michael Cathedral, St. Sophia Cathedral. Those two Cathedrals are 1000 years old, they are one of the best cathedral's I've ever seen. If you have never been in orthodox churches, you definitely need ot visit them. St. Michaels cathedral has free entrance, but for Sophia you will need to pay around 5$. Both of them are located in downtown, not far from each other.

Andrew's Descent. This is very historical and famous street in Kyiv. If you love architecture - this place must be the first in your list. But even if you are not interested in architecture so much, there are a lot of street sellers and you can buy some souvenirs, pictures, interesting gifts for your friends. It's street of theatres, restaurants, museums.
Peyzazhna Alleya (Kyiv Fashion Park). Very creative and unique place in Kyiv. There are so many creative modern sculptures. Great place to take a cool pictures. And also you will have opportunity to see the downtown of Kyiv from the high point. It's located near Andrew's Descent.
Museum of WW2. This museum has a very big territory, so you can walking just outside. The most important destination - The statue of Mother Motherland - one of the highest statue in the world. Also you can visit museum inside and find a lot of interesting things, if you are interested in war topic.
Shevchenko Park. It's a great park in the downtown. There are a lot of interesting art things, like benches, statues etc.. In warm season there are lot of people, children, students.. It's great place to relax, make new friends, have a rest and enjoy Kyiv.
Vozdvyzhenka. This is historical area in the downtown, which was totally rebuilt 10 years ago. You can see totally new houses in style of 19 century of Kyiv. You can feel the spirit of old Kyiv, take an awesome pictures and relax in the summer, because this place is surrounded by wooden hills.
Arsenalna subway station. This is the deepest subway station in the world. I would suggest you to visit all subway station in downtown and see how do the look. You pay just once when you enter to the subway and you can spent even the whole day there. So if you have a lot of time and don't have a lot of money - you can enjoy Kyiv's subway.
Arch of Friendship of Nations. Very famous place located in the downtown of Kyiv with great view into the Dnipro river.
Kyiv-Pechersk Lavra - one of the oldest church in Kyiv, with very luxurious interior.
Botanique garden. It's a very big park in Kyiv with a great view into old city and Dnipro river. But the best time to visit it is spring, summer and early fall.
Mamaeva sloboda. It's green park with elements of Ukrainian folk houses, churches.
Pyrogiv. Museum near the Kyiv where you can see all traditional houses of Ukrainians from different region. You can see people in national clothes and try Ukrainian national food.
Mystetsky Arsenal. Art gallery where you can always find some interesting exhibition and spend 3-4 hours educating yourself.
Mariinsky park. Great place in the downtown which looks so good in the green time.
Dream Town. This is huge shopping center where every section is built in different style: Chinese with Chinese restaurant, Italian with Italian restaurants, Brazilian, French, Japanese etc...
Ocean plaza. It's shopping mall with the huge aquarium inside. Some people say that it's the biggest in Europe.
Lavina mall. The biggest shopping mall in Ukraine with singing fountains inside, with entertainment park and thousands of shops and restaurants.

So, you’ve decided to go to Kyiv!
Initially, I was only going to Kiev to visit Chernobyl, but ended up falling in love with the city. Here’s the rundown and a list of what do to in Kiev, one of the most beautiful cities I have visited in Eastern Europe.
The residents of Kiev are extremely friendly, although communication was a little difficult for us. We did find a lot of Kiev residents were not able to speak English, which did make small things such as ordering food, getting from the metro station or taxis interesting, but no more difficult than other non-English speaking countries.
Ukraine has its own currency called Hryvnia, which can easily be withdrawn from local ATMs or converted ideally from Euros or USD. Kiev is a relatively cheap city to visit when you compare it to the rest of Eastern and Western Europe. For example, a bottle of beer in Rome is 4 euro, and an average price for a bottle of beer in Kiev is 1.4 euro. We definitely found eating out at local Ukrainian resturants really affordable, which was a real treat because their local cuisine is delicious. Our dinners were the most expensive meals for us and would generally cost us around 20 to 25 euros for a 3-course meal, but you can easily have a nice budget meal for 5 – 7 euros.
When it comes to accommodation, just like anywhere in Europe, you can find budget and expensive hotels. We stayed in close to the main square in an apartment-style hotel that cost approximately 60 euro a night, and it was beautiful! It had a unique entry that was original to the building, and the room was very modern and had a sauna. We visited in Winter, so having a sauna in the room was perfect. Hotels range from 5 to 10 euros for a 1 to 2-star room, 10 to 50 euro for a 3 to 4-star room, and 50 to 100 euro on average for a 5-star room.
Kiev is full of wide streets and grand buildings, full of details and colour, which was a complete surprise to us. It’s known as the city of domes, and you can definitely see why! The city has many beautiful cathedrals and churches, and we definitely a must see! It’s worthwhile visiting them as they look very different from churches and cathedrals in the rest of Europe.
The ones we would recommend are: Saint Andrews Church, which completed construction in 1747 and boasts beautiful green and gold details; Saint Sophia Cathedral is one of the city’s best-known landmarks and the first heritage site in Ukraine; and Saint Michaels Monastry, which is still a functioning monastery in Kiev and can’t be missed with its light-blue exterior and gold domes.

KIEV - It is the center of Ukrainian culture, full of theaters, museums, religious sites, modern buildings and ancient ruins.
According to a legend in the Tale of Bygone Years, Kiev was founded by three brothers Kiy, Schek and Khoriv and sister Lybed as the center of the Polyana tribe and named after their older brother.
In 1982, Kiev turned 1,500 years old.
